Baltic Recruitment are currently looking for warehouse operatives, pickers and packers in the Ashington area. This role is a great opportunity as it is a long-term Temp to Perm position.
NO EXPERIENCE NEEDED
DUTIES
- Working from order sheets and picking stock
- Working on stacking systems
- Quality checking
- Using hand held scanners
- Picking products to be dispatched
- Labelling if/when required

How to prepare for a job interview at Baltic Recruitment Services
✨Know the Role Inside Out
Before heading into the interview, make sure you understand the duties of a warehouse operative. Familiarise yourself with tasks like picking stock, quality checking, and using hand-held scanners. This will show your potential employer that you're genuinely interested in the role.
✨Dress for Success
Even though this is a warehouse position, first impressions matter! Dress smartly and comfortably for your interview. It doesn’t have to be formal, but looking tidy and presentable can set a positive tone right from the start.
✨Prepare for Common Questions
Think about questions you might be asked, such as how you would handle a busy day or what you know about safety procedures in a warehouse. Practising your answers can help you feel more confident and articulate during the interview.
✨Show Your Willingness to Learn
Since no experience is needed for this role, emphasise your eagerness to learn and adapt. Share examples of how you've quickly picked up new skills in the past, even if they’re from different jobs or experiences. This will demonstrate your potential to thrive in the position.
